Output 58de18bfd9bc9ec144e03bc33f39be7e83cd0c6472f23365a7c01dffa1f30dd1:7

value
795200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06b27b9e43bda65609450f67f4d08c08ee8f4eee OP_EQUAL
address
32JRnuKcfKDMBDpV9idTjDCsZpn8tynMzb
transaction
58de18bfd9bc9ec144e03bc33f39be7e83cd0c6472f23365a7c01dffa1f30dd1
confirmations
374418
spent
true